Performance and Powertrain: Hyryder's Hybrid Advantage
When it comes to performance, the Toyota Hyryder and the Urban Cruiser offer different experiences, primarily due to their powertrain configurations. The Hyryder's biggest draw is undoubtedly its hybrid technology. This is where the Hyryder really shines. You get the option of a strong hybrid system, which combines a petrol engine with an electric motor, delivering exceptional fuel economy and reduced emissions. This means fewer trips to the gas station and a smaller environmental impact. For those who prioritize efficiency and eco-friendliness, the Hyryder's hybrid is a significant advantage. The Urban Cruiser, on the other hand, typically comes with a petrol engine that, while not a hybrid, still provides a smooth and reliable driving experience. Its focus is more on providing a straightforward, practical driving experience rather than pushing the boundaries of fuel efficiency. The Hyryder also gives you the option of all-wheel drive in some variants, giving you extra grip and stability, especially on less-than-perfect road conditions. This can be a real plus if you frequently drive on rough roads or encounter challenging weather conditions. The Urban Cruiser, while solid in its performance, doesn't offer the same level of fuel efficiency or the option of all-wheel drive in all its models. So, if you live in a place with unpredictable weather or enjoy venturing off the beaten path, the Hyryder's all-wheel drive could be a game-changer. Both cars are designed with city driving in mind, but the Hyryder's hybrid technology provides a clear advantage in terms of fuel economy and eco-friendliness. The Urban Cruiser, with its standard petrol engine, still performs well, but it might not be the best choice if fuel efficiency is your top priority. In terms of driving dynamics, both vehicles offer comfortable rides, but the Hyryder's hybrid system can give you a smoother, more refined driving experience, especially in stop-and-go traffic. So, whether you are concerned about your carbon footprint, then the Hyryder's hybrid powertrain is hard to beat! The Urban Cruiser provides a great balance of performance and practicality for those who want a reliable and straightforward SUV.
Features and Technology: Hyryder's Modern Edge
Let's move on to the features and technology, which is a key area where the Toyota Hyryder often steals the show. The Hyryder is typically packed with the latest tech, designed to enhance both your comfort and convenience. You can expect features like a touchscreen infotainment system with smartphone integration (think Apple CarPlay and Android Auto), allowing you to seamlessly connect your phone for navigation, music, and calls. Moreover, the Hyryder often includes a suite of safety features, such as multiple airbags, electronic stability control, and sometimes even adv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S) like lane departure warning and adaptive cruise control. These features help keep you safe on the road. The Urban Cruiser, while not as flashy, still offers a decent array of features. It usually comes equipped with a user-friendly infotainment system, although it might not be as advanced as the Hyryder's. You can usually find features like a rearview camera and parking sensors, making it easier to maneuver in tight spots. When you're looking at comfort features, the Hyryder might offer a more premium feel, with things like automatic climate control, a leather-wrapped steering wheel, and perhaps even a sunroof. These add to the overall driving experience, making it more enjoyable, especially on long journeys. The Urban Cruiser, while still comfortable, might focus more on practicality and affordability, meaning some of these premium features might not be available. Both vehicles have their strengths when it comes to technology, the Hyryder often offers a more advanced and feature-rich experience, perfect if you love staying connected and having the latest gadgets. The Urban Cruiser is still a great choice if you prioritize essential features and a simple, user-friendly interface. So, if you're a tech enthusiast who loves the latest gadgets and advanced safety features, the Hyryder is likely to impress. The Urban Cruiser offers a more straightforward experience, which is great for those who want a reliable and easy-to-use SUV without all the bells and whistles.
